Key Ingredients
- Glucosamine – Supports cartilage repair and joint structure
- Chondroitin – Helps slow cartilage breakdown and supports cushioning
- MSM (Methylsulfonylmethane) – Helps reduce inflammation and joint discomfort
- Omega-3 Fatty Acids – Supports joint lubrication and inflammatory balance
- Hyaluronic Acid – Helps maintain smooth joint movement
Recommended Dosage
Dosage may vary based on weight and veterinary advice.
General guideline:
- Up to 10 kg: 1 tablet daily
- 11–25 kg: 2 tablets daily
- 26–40 kg: 3 tablets daily
- Over 40 kg: 4 tablets daily (may be divided)
Administer orally. Can be given with or without food.

Safety Information
Canitone is generally well tolerated when used as directed.
Possible mild effects (rare):
- Temporary digestive upset during initial use
Use with caution:
- Dogs with known ingredient allergies
- Pregnant or lactating dogs (veterinary advice required)
- Dogs on long-term medication (consult a veterinarian)
